North Ridgeville, OH vs Upper Arlington, OH

Compare the housing, tax, cost, income, safety, school, and climate facts that are available for both places. The table shows the numbers without declaring one city universally better.

A household earning $85,000 in North Ridgeville needs about $96,000 in Upper Arlington to keep the same lifestyle.
Coming from Upper Arlington, $85,000 of lifestyle costs about $74,500 in North Ridgeville.

Questions & answers
Is North Ridgeville cheaper than Upper Arlington?
North Ridgeville has the lower day-to-day cost index (83 vs 109 against a national 100). The other differences are shown facet by facet in the table.
What household income in Upper Arlington equals $85,000 in North Ridgeville?
A household earning $85,000 in North Ridgeville needs about $96,000 in Upper Arlington to keep the same lifestyle; coming the other way, $85,000 of Upper Arlington lifestyle costs about $74,500 in North Ridgeville.
